Dental bonding is a cosmetic dental procedure which will improve the appearance of your teeth. It involves the application of tooth-coloured composite material to the tooth’s surface to correct chips, cracks, discolouration, and other imperfections. Dental bonding is a cost-effective and relatively quick procedure that provides a beautiful, natural-looking smile. Here are seven benefits of dental bonding.

Cost-Effectiveness
One of the main benefits of dental bonding is that it is a cost-effective procedure. Dental bonding is much more affordable than other cosmetic dental procedures, like veneers & crowns. This makes it an excellent option for those who want to improve the appearance of their teeth without breaking the bank.
-
Quick Results
Another benefit of dental bonding is that it can provide you with quick results. The procedure usually takes only one visit to the dentist and can be completed in as little as 30 minutes. This makes it an excellent option for those who want to improve the appearance of their teeth quickly and efficiently.
-
Non-Invasive
Dental bonding is a non-invasive procedure, meaning it does not require cutting or drilling of the tooth. This makes it an excellent option for those who want to improve their teeth’ appearance without undergoing invasive procedures.
